Witryna18 lis 2024 · Like the rest of Italy, Sicily has a bevy of signature pasta dishes. Hit Catania for pasta alla Norma (pasta topped with eggplant, basil, fresh ricotta and tomatoes). In Palermo, try pasta con le sarde (pasta with sardines, pine nuts, raisins, fennel and breadcrumbs). Celebrate the Southeast’s earthy flavors with lolli con le fave (hand ...

While this can mean simply “cabbage,” it can also add a little bit of sass to your vocabulary. klay thompson covers propsWitrynaThe main advantages of living in Sicily are beautiful weather, rich history and culture, amazing cuisine, and breathtaking landscapes. On the other hand, Sicily might disappoint you with its endless bureaucracy, dysfunctionality, piles of trash everywhere, and terrible infrastructure.
